[[File:Pooh's_Adventures_of_Star_Wars_Episode_V_The_Empire_Strikes_Back_Poster.jpg|thumb|The Poster for "Pooh's Adventures of Star Wars Episode V: The Empire Strikes Back".]]'''''Pooh's Adventures of Star Wars Episode V: The Empire Strikes Back''''' is the fifth installment in the ''Pooh's Adventures of Star Wars'' saga Created by BowserMovies1989. The events take place 3 years after the events of Episode IV. It appeared on YouTube on 11-7-2009. Imperial forces were unable to find the Rebels for a long period after their evacuation, until they deployed their Imperial probes onto an ice planet known as Hoth. ==Plot== It is now three years after the events in ''[[Pooh's Adventures of Star Wars Episode IV: A New Hope|A New Hope]]''. The [[Alliance to Restore the Republic|Rebel Alliance]] has been forced to flee its base on Yavin 4 and establish a new one on the ice planet of [[Hoth]]. An [[Imperial Star Destroyer]] dispatched by the [[Sith Lord]] [[Anakin Skywalker|Darth Vader]], continuing his quest for [[Luke Skywalker]], launches thousands of [[viper probe droid|probe droids]] across the galaxy, one of which lands on Hoth and begins its survey of the planet. Luke Skywalker, on patrol astride his [[tauntaun]], discovers the probe, which he mistakes for a meteorite. After reporting to comrade [[Han Solo]] that he'll investigate the site, Luke is knocked unconscious by a deadly [[wampa]] creature. When Luke does not come back to [[Echo Base]], Han Solo goes out on his tauntaun to search for him in an encroaching storm. Upon waking up, Luke finds himself hanging upside down in an ice cave; his eyes opening to the sight of another wampa eating his tauntaun. Using the Force, Luke is able to pull his [[lightsaber]] towards himself. After he ignites it, he cuts himself free and cuts off the attacking wampa's arm, running out of the cave and escaping into the cold night of Hoth. Luke tries to make his way to Echo Base on foot, but finds himself caught in a blizzard and collapses in the snow. Suddenly, he sees the [[Force ghost]] of [[Obi-Wan Kenobi]] appear before him. Ben tells Luke to go to [[Dagobah]] to undergo training under [[Yoda]], a [[Grand Master|Jedi Grand Master]]. After the spirit disappears, Han rides up to an almost unconscious Luke, who is mumbling indistinctly about Ben, Yoda and Dagobah. At this point, the tauntaun that Han was riding on collapses and dies from the extreme cold. To keep Luke warm during the blizzard, Han uses Luke's lightsaber to cut open the dead tauntaun and places Luke in it. Han then sets about erecting a shelter that he and Luke will stay in during the night. They are forced to stay out during the night as the aircraft ([[T-47 airspeeder|snowspeeders]]) that the Rebels use for atmospheric flight had not yet been adapted for the extremely low temperatures of the Hoth night and are therefore unable to mount a rescue operation to retrieve Han and Luke. The next morning, Rebel Pilots flying the snowspeeders set out from Echo Base to search for the missing men. [[Zev Senesca]], one of the pilots in [[Rogue Group]] makes contact with Han over comlink and the pair are rescued. When they are taken back to base, Luke is put in a [[bacta]] [[Bacta tank|tank]] for healing under the care of medical droid, [[2-1B]]. [[Leia Organa Solo|Princess Leia Organa]] tries to urge Han to stay with the rebels, and when Han assumes it is because she has feelings for him, Leia loses her temper and calls him a "stuck-up, half-witted, scruffy-looking [[nerf herder]]." Meanwhile, the probe droid has spotted signs that indicate Hoth is occupied and sends a signal to the Imperial fleet, shortly before being destroyed by Han Solo and Chewbacca. Aboard the ''[[Executor]]'', Admiral [[Kendal Ozzel]] dismisses the information as evidence of smugglers, nothing more. However, [[Darth]] Vader knows better and orders the fleet to Hoth.
